英文摘要

For compact submanifolds in Euclidean and Spherical space forms with Ricci curvature bounded below by a function $α(n,k,H,c)$ of mean curvature, we prove that the submanifold is either isometric to the Einstein Clifford torus, or a topological sphere for the maximal bound $α(n,[\frac{n}{2}],H,c)$, or has up to $k$-th homology groups vanishing. This gives an almost complete (except for the differentiable sphere theorem) characterization of compact submanifolds with pinched Ricci curvature, generalizing celebrated rigidity results obtained by Ejiri, Xu-Tian, Xu-Gu, Xu-Leng-Gu, Vlachos, Dajczer-Vlachos.
